Introducing Betta Fish
Betta fish additionally renowned as Siamese fighting fish are the most preferred variety of pet fish as they are lovely in their individual ways. Nearly all of the Betta fish possess brilliantly coloured lengthy fins, and scales. Guy fish are more vibrantly coloured by way of hues ranging from scarlet to cobalt, and are more destructive than their female counterparts. Betta fish are known in some parts of the world to be made to fight for gambling bets. Normally their natural habitat is in slower moving waters and need water temperatures that are warmer. It is common sense to add a heater that fits with your tank to maintain a warmth of at least 70 degrees in aquariums keeping Betta fish.
Apart from this, Bettas need a measure of small insects, or insect larvae along with normal regime of flake foods, or frozen fried fish foods. Bettas should be given a good amount of space in their aquariums to allow them both more breathing space and give them ample opportunity to move around their long thins unobstructed. Bettas need a good quality of oxygen as they breath it from the air, Bettas are Labyrinth.
Additional Attention Necessary
It is a common piece of information that Betta fish possess a pretty forceful temper. It wouldn’t be advised to hold two male Betta fish together, or to put in a brand new one along with an existing Betta fish. This may possibly turn unpleasant if the stronger Betta fish begin attacking, or wounding the weaker ones. Seperating Bettas that are fighting should be done for the safe keeping of any others.
Thus if one has to add together two male Betta fish inside one tank, next there are the options of using mesh dividers or fish condos to part the Bettas. It is also better to keep the fish tank containing Betta fish covered when viable.
